Ask on the cruise forum also. Then, look carefully at all reviews. Some rivers are more prone to flooding or low water levels, forcing river cruises to become land cruises. Some times of year are better in that respect than others. Some rivers are better. Also, look at docking situations. Some boats tie up together, limiting views, and some docks are in industrial areas, making it difficult to go off on your own. Do a lot of research before making a decision.
